Park’s commemorates the centenary of Great War

A Matlock park is commemorating the centenary of the First World War.

A sculpture standing amongst wild flowers in Hall Leys Park and the vegetable plot in front of the trench symbolise the struggles that people experienced during the war.

The bed, designed, and made by members of Matlock In Bloom has been appreciated by visitors to the park over the last few.

Twiggs of Matlock manufactured the steel profile and Derwent Treescapes provided the lavender edging plants.
